I have started a wall collage in my hall. Mixing frames, media and colours on the wall. It is constantly a work in progress, but that makes it more fun. I have picked up some frames for £1 from second-hand stores and found music posters at flea markets which I then had framed professionally. I am goign to fill in the gaps with polaroid photos and some Japanese Art. I was originally inspired by Erin Wasson's house (see below), I love how mismatched it is, yet quite symmetrical without being too neat. So on our recent trip to L.A, we stopped by the famous Amoeba Records on Sunset Boulevard and bought a Velvet Underground record for $15. My partner is converting the record onto MP3 and I framed the sleeve with a frame I bought at Target (more about this amazing store soon) for $10. Framed Art for $25, and an individual collage wall, see the results below.
